Overview

The Quality Engineer will apply engineering knowledge, problem solving skills and ingenuity to resolve quality issues for all Humanscale Products. They will also drive continuous improvement for product and process performance.

Responsibilities

  • Customer Focus and Continuous Improvement
    • Directly responsible for ensuring all quality standards for products are met prior to shipment to customer.
    • Investigates, conducts tests or experiments, gathers data, and performs preliminary analysis for product performance issues.
    • Conducts root cause investigation and is responsible to drive implementation of corrective action and preventive measures.
    • Directly responsible for customer complaint reduction to assigned Humanscale Product line.
    • Initiates, leads and participates in continuous improvement projects.
  • Operations
    • Will work with experienced QE to disposition non-conforming material.
    • Oversee efforts and works with production, inventory control and Inspection teams to quarantine/segregate parts when nonconformance is identified.
    • Directs workers engaged in measuring, testing product and tabulating data concerning test set up and procedure to follow.
    • When sort/rework of nonconforming material is required, provide technical support as required.
    • Participate in Lean activities including Kaizen events, 6S audits.
  • Quality Systems
    • Develops and initiates standards and methods for inspection, testing, and evaluation, utilizing knowledge in mechanical and electrical engineering fields.
    • Devises sampling procedures and develops forms and instructions for recording, evaluating, and reporting quality and reliability data.
    • Will contribute to compile/update training material, SOP’s, and QC Criteria as required.

Qualifications

  • B.S. degree or equivalent in a mechanical or electrical engineering discipline with a minimum of 2 years’ experience in Quality engineering within a manufacturing environment. 
  • Ability to read and understand engineering drawings.
  • Solid communication skills, able to work effectively in cross functional teams.
  • Excellent interpersonal skills to lead teams and drive projects to successful closure.  
  • Demonstrate accuracy, attention to detail and ability to work well in team environment.
